A Clinical Study to Evaluate the Efficacy and Safety of SIM0417 Orally Co-Administered With Ritonavir in Symptomatic Adult Participants With Mild to Moderate COVID-19
RandomizedParallel-groupQuadruple-blindTreatment
Summary
This Phase Ⅱ/Ⅲ study is to evaluate whether or not there is a difference in time recovery of COVID-19 signs and symptoms through Day 29 between SIM0417/ritonavir and placebo.
